Homes of temple workers dismantled without notification in Karnatak

Homes of temple workers dismantled without notification in Karnatak

The Karnatak government took decisive actions after unauthorized demolition of houses assigned to the temple of the temple in the Dakshina Kannada district. In a shocking incident reported on February 4, six houses were razed by a masked group with heavy machines, allegedly without a prior warning.

This group, consisting of 12 attackers with a hood armed in Lathis, demolished around 2 am without current state officials. The lack of prior notification and forced eviction of families without allowing them to recover things, caused a serious criticism and caused the author’s rapid actions.

In response to complaints lodged by the affected persons, the secretary of the Main Minister instructed local officials about the examination of the case. The complaint was also sent to the Commissioner for Religious Endation in order to obtain further funds, seek responsibility and restore for resettled families.
